I have two boxes and 0.32 version of usbjtag nt software. I loaded nvram, boot, etc. from a working unit and both of them started to work ok (basic channels) but one of the boxes did not show the guide so in this one I tried to re-load the files again (with the write option as normal) but I do not know what I did wrong since the box became dead and now the software detects the box but freezes every time I intend to write boot and plat. The software works ok with other box and I can write all as I wish. What is the issue with this box? Why the software can not write the important files? Any help will be greatly appreciated. Thanks

Looks to me the boot is bad. Just use sprogram/erase to program the proper boot and you can then program the box normally.
Freeze means that the box is not able to program in fast mode.

Thanks to justoneguy, usbbdm and tundra the problem was solved. I used low speed for erasing each file (boot,plat, etc.) and then I used sprogram to write them back and the box is now working properly including the guide.
